Output 629408fb9c28d64b86d53eef135a7db306331f8ec0e6aecfda92489b94198d4e:0

value
93514987
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5091ec1613b7f1f419c44c59891514739a251329 OP_EQUALVERIFY OP_CHECKSIG
address
LSZy8QspAfe41G9xppxyDBTHJv78bm614E
transaction
629408fb9c28d64b86d53eef135a7db306331f8ec0e6aecfda92489b94198d4e
spent
true